Hi, I have several dgn files each with hundreds of elements that all have attached tag information. Now I need to update the Tag Set definition and add a new column. This change of tag definition is not automatically published to the existing elements (witch makes sense in a way since the tag information is a part of the element) and the only way I have figured out to do update the elements is to export all the information to a database and then import it again as Tags.
&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;
&amp;nbsp;Is there any way to somehow run a update on my files to update existing elements with changes in Tag set definition ?
